Dealing with Anxiety and Stress

It's hardly unexpected that worry and tension are key factors driving people pursue psychological support in modern times. In your fast-paced life, you may struggle to handle racing thoughts and recurring concerns. Partnering with a qualified therapist, you will discover evidence-based strategies such as mindfulness techniques and relaxation exercises. These approaches allow you to remain centered in the now, release muscle tension, and stop repetitive anxiety. Mindfulness practices, like focused breathing and body scans, help you notice your thinking without criticism. Calming techniques, like systematic relaxation or mental imagery, can reduce discomfort and enhance coping ability. With compassionate guidance, you will build techniques to handle pressure more efficiently and establish better equilibrium in your everyday life.

How Do I Verify a Psychologist's Credentials in Iowa?

When checking a psychologist's qualifications in Iowa, first checking the Iowa Board of Psychology's online license verification system. This resource allows you to verify licensing status and confirms the psychologist meets all state requirements. You can furthermore inquire with the psychologist face-to-face about their academic background, licensure, and background. Feel free to contact the licensing board if you have doubts. Following these measures helps you feel confident about receiving qualified and ethical care.

Do Iowa Psychologists Offer Virtual Sessions?

Absolutely, you can receive virtual therapy sessions with Iowa psychologists. Telehealth accessibility has expanded, enabling for you to receive support from home. Many psychologists now offer secure video or phone appointments, prioritizing your privacy and security. Studies demonstrate virtual therapy is just as effective as in-person therapy, so you won't need to settle for less when it comes to quality. If you're interested, ask potential providers about their virtual session options and confidentiality protocols.
